After becoming stranded on Concordia, a parallel version of Earth, military brat Davinney Keith and her new friends uncover a horrifying scandal involving the local government, known as the Tribunal. But as the Tribunal's sinister plot unravels, tensions within their group threaten to tear them apart. With her Earth at risk and time running out, can they heal the rifts that exist among them and find a way back to her world in time to stop the genocide?
